Baja California
Soils are mostly sand, clay and granite, and elevations range from 300 to 2,600 feet. A variety of grapes flourish here, primarily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Tempranillo, Grenache and Syrah for reds, and Chenin Blanc, Sauvignon Blanc and Chardonnay for whites.
